8. Hubs and Host Responsibilities

What are Hubs?

Hubs are community spaces within Veil. Hub owners and administrators create and manage these spaces, subject to these Terms. A Hub may include features such as chat channels, posts, galleries, event scheduling, news feeds, custom branding, and other modules made available by Veil from time to time.

Veil's Role:

Veil provides the infrastructure and tools for Hubs. We are not the publisher or editor of Hub content. Hubs are private, invite-only spaces, not public forums or directories. Our role is limited to providing the platform and enforcing these Terms when violations are reported.
